Primary schools across the Isle of Man have been learning about other countries in preparation for the Commonwealth Youth Games.
The Isle of Man hosts the Games between September 7 and 13 and 71 nations be competing here.
Ian Longshaw, a school improvement advisor on the Island, said it's been three years in the making to make sure young, local kids know as much about each of the visiting countries as possible, so they have been paired up.
